Homemade Limoncello

Ingredients:

6 Unwaxed Lemons

500g Caster Sugar

200ml Water

1 litre of Vodka

Method:

1. Using a vegetable peeler carefully remove the peel from the lemons withought taking any of the white pith. Then squeeze the juice from the lemons and leave aside.

2. Put the caster sugar and water into a saucepan and over a low heat stir until the sugar is disolved. Add the lemon peel to the liquid and bring to the boil.  Then simmer for 15 minutes.

3. Now add the juice of the lemons and bring back to the boil and once again simmer for 5 minutes. Leave the juice to cool for 15 minutes.

4. Transfer all the liquid into a large jar and add the vodka. Cover tightly and leave for two weeks. Every two days, just shake the jar carefully.

5. Final step is to strain the liqueur and pour into bottles. add a strip of zest to each bottle. Serve chilled straight after dinner.
